Mixing bowl birthday cake

Buttercream icing

  1. Step 1

    Preheat oven to 180°C/160°C fan-forced. Grease an 8 cup-capacity metal pudding steamer. Prepare packet cakes following packet directions. Pour into prepared steamer. Bake for 1 hour or until a skewer inserted in centre comes out clean. Stand for 10 minutes. Turn out onto a wire rack to cool.

  2. Step 2

    Make icing: Using an electric mixer, beat butter in a bowl until pale. Gradually add icing sugar mixture and milk, beating to combine. Tint icing with food colouring.

  3. Step 3

    Using a serrated knife, level top of cake. Make a 5cm-deep cut around top of cake, entertaining little chef party leaving a 1.5cm border. Using a spoon, scoop cake out to form a well. Spread cake, including well, with icing. Using picture above as a guide, decorate cake with sour strap, trimming to fit.

  4. Step 4

    Fill cake well with lollies. Decorate with a wooden spoon and lollies. Serve.
